Suzuki Other tech info

Engine Size (cc)Engine Size (cc):370 WarrantyWarranty:No TypeType:Motocross

Suzuki Other description

matching numbers   Powder coated frame, all newplastics and new tires, all OEM parts: wheels, spokes, levers, pipe, muffler, carb., air box, etc. only bars and throttle not OEM. New piston and top end. Has not been ridden or started since restoration.

Suzuki MotoGP Development Video 2

Tue, 07 Jan 2014

The second programme in the Suzuki MotoGP development video documentary series is now live. Episode 2 moves to Twin Ring Motegi in Japan in April and May where MotoGP rider Randy De Puniet joins the team as test rider and Davide Brivio is appointed as Suzuki MotoGP Test Team Manager; with first interviews with both rider and manager. Suzuki GSX-R1000 Anniversary Edition

Thu, 02 Jul 2015

Celebrating the 30th anniversary of the Gixer, Suzuki is releasing a limited edition GSX-R1000 in the colors of the 1985 GSX-R750.
